RESOURCES AND SECTIONS
1. General Collection – This
contains books for circulation that can be borrowed for two
weeks. It is divided into the following sub-collections:
| |
a. Fiction – arranged in
alphabetical order according to the author’s last name.
b. Non-Fiction – classified according to
the Library of Congress and Dewey Decimal Classification
Systems.
c. Filipiniana – follows the arrangement
of the non-fiction collection.
d. Biography – alphabetically arranged
according to the subject’s last name. |
2. Reference Collection – Reference
books such as encyclopedias, dictionaries, atlases, bibliographies,
including a separate sub-collection of Filipiniana references
and special collection are placed here. Books in this section
are for room use only.
3. Periodical Collection – This
is where the loose and bound issues of local/foreign magazines
and newspapers are housed. The Library also subscribes to periodical
indexes that can help the users locate articles of specific
topics. These materials are for room use only.

4. Vertical File Collection –
This is a collection of newspaper clippings, brochures, handouts,
and other ephemeral materials that are kept inside long brown
envelopes and arranged alphabetically by subject headings. These
materials are for room use only.
5. Young Reader’s Collection
– a new section intended to encourage the students to read more.
It houses award-winning fiction books and other types of literature
recommended for young readers. These books may be borrowed for
two weeks except for the ones in the Reserve Section that can
be borrowed for one week.
6. Electronic Media Collection
– is composed of encyclopedia and other references on various
topics that are stored in compact discs. They can be borrowed
from the circulation counter. Viewing and printing can be done
on any assigned computer/printer. These materials are for room

7. Reserve Book Collection –
These are the books recommended by the subject teachers to supplement
the prescribed textbooks. These materials can be checked out
at 4p.m. and returned on or before 8a.m. the next day.
